Castle Sterkenburg, in Driebergen in the centre of The Netherlands, has received a sum of € 3.307.914,00 for several restoration projects. This is over 10% of the total sum granted for restorations this year by the Ministry for education, culture and science (OCW).
Sterkenburg, which is privately owned and currently in use as an apartment building, has retained one of its medieval features: the round tower. The rest of the current building is the result of additions from the 18th century and an all but complete rebuild in the 19th century. The restoration grants are all for the buildings on the premises: the castle itself, the gardener’s house and the coach house. Continue Reading »
